Output 8f3ca687531575c531a29d4fadfff73a18eab83126c025b5b7a473d1122359af:0

value
71954184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4143877cbc3adcca80544622528ef98553926db5 OP_EQUAL
address
37e6k2XKyxMSEAMr3whQoHN3sWEt8pqzbK
transaction
8f3ca687531575c531a29d4fadfff73a18eab83126c025b5b7a473d1122359af
spent
true